Output 7e54dce02d9546f08621cfba992304a16f1a336723aecfda2f66a01d3360d49a:2

value
62645
script pubkey
OP_0 OP_PUSHBYTES_20 a344ef900a7814af7a5927825018292a734f3aab
address
tb1q5dzwlyq20q2277jey7p9qxpf9fe57w4tfx42nn
transaction
7e54dce02d9546f08621cfba992304a16f1a336723aecfda2f66a01d3360d49a
confirmations
82111
spent
true